A South Dakota Shareholders Agreement is a legally binding document that outlines the rights, responsibilities, and obligations of shareholders in a corporation that is based in South Dakota. It serves as an essential tool for establishing clear and transparent rules governing the relationship between shareholders and is designed to protect the interests of all parties involved. Some relevant keywords associated with South Dakota Shareholders Agreement may include: 1. Shareholders: The agreement primarily focuses on the rights and obligations of shareholders, who are individuals or entities that own shares in a corporation. 2. Corporation: The agreement pertains specifically to corporations, which are legal entities formed for the purpose of doing business. It can be applicable to both closely held corporations and larger public corporations. 3. Rights and Responsibilities: The agreement outlines the rights and responsibilities of shareholders, such as voting rights, decision-making processes, dividend distributions, financial contributions, and non-compete clauses. 4. Transfer of Shares: The agreement addresses the procedures and restrictions on the transfer of shares among shareholders, which may include rights of first refusal or pre-emption rights. 5. Dispute Resolution: It includes mechanisms and procedures for resolving disputes among shareholders, such as mediation, arbitration, or other alternative dispute resolution methods. 6. Confidentiality and Non-Disclosure: The agreement may include provisions to safeguard sensitive corporate information and trade secrets. 7. Types of Shareholders Agreements: Different types of Shareholders Agreements can be tailored based on the specific needs of the corporation and its shareholders. Some possible variations may include: — Voting Agreements: These agreements focus on voting rights and decision-making processes, ensuring that shareholders have a say in important corporate matters. — Buy-Sell Agreements: These agreements establish provisions for the sale and purchase of shares between shareholders. They typically outline how shares can be bought or sold in cases of death, disability, retirement, or disagreement between shareholders. — Stock Option Agreements: These agreements pertain to the issuance and exercise of stock options, which are contractual rights granted to certain employees or individuals that allow them to buy company shares at a predetermined price within a specific timeframe. In summary, a South Dakota Shareholders Agreement is an important legal document that governs the rights and responsibilities of shareholders in a corporation based in South Dakota. It ensures transparency, protects the interests of all shareholders, and provides mechanisms for dispute resolution and effective decision-making.

The shareholders agreement should set out matters that are reserved for the board and those matters that will require shareholder approval. It will also set out the level of majority required to pass a particular resolution. Decisions reserved for the board typically relate to the day?to?day management of the company.
